Примечания к выпуску Viewer v.6.3.*
Примечания к выпуску Viewer v.6.3.*
Всегда указывайте версию Viewer, которую вы хотите использовать в вашем приложении. Сделайте это, чтобы избежать каких-либо фатальных изменений, также вы можете протестировать функциональность в своей dev среде перед переходом на новую версию.
ДОБАВЛЕНО
Расширение Autodesk.PDF - прототип загрузки PDF-файлов с векторным рендерингом
Пример кода:
- // Создание Viewer-а и загрузка файла PDF на 1 странице
- Autodesk.Viewing.Initializer(options, function() {
- var viewer = new Autodesk.Viewing.Viewer3D(div,config3d);
- viewer.start()
- viewer.loadExtension('Autodesk.PDF').then(function() {
- // URL parameter `page` will override value passed to loadModel
- viewer.loadModel('path/to/file.pdf', { page: 1 });
- });
- });
Расширение Autodesk.DocumentBrowser
Данное расширение добавляет кнопку, нажатие которой вызывает панель, отображающую все 3D сцены и 2D-виды, которые указаны в манифесте JSON
viewer.loadDocumentNode
Новый API для загрузки модели: viewer.loadDocumentNode(lmvDocument, bubbleNode, options). Здесь
lmvDocument - экземпляр документа, принадлежащего загружаемой модели
bubbleNode - указывает, какой конкретный узел из манифеста документа должен загружаться
options (не обязательный параметр) - параметры, которые передаются в метод Viewer3D.loadModel. Может быть опущен в большинстве случаев. options.loadOptions.skipHiddenFragments:bool - установите true, чтобы не загружать изначально скрытые меши.
ИЗМЕНЕНО
Панель свойств.
В заголовке панели свойств теперь показывается выбранный элемент в модели
Вернули функцию Autodesk.Viewing.Private.getHtmlTemplate для совместимости
ПРОЧЕЕ
- Значение прозрачности по умолчанию для BlendShader, значения радиуса и интенсивности по умолчанию для SAOShader.
- Все ссылки в документации теперь ведут на forge.developer.com вместо developer.autodesk.com
- Теперь интерфейс загрузки модели скрывается сразу как только геометрия готова для рендеринга
ИСПРАВЛЕНО
- В IE11 отсутствовал Uint8Array.prototype.slice, что приводило к ошибкам при загрузке страниц PDF
- Позиция видового куба теперь корректно отображается при смене на вид "сверху", "спереди" и т.д.
- Исправлен некорректный цвет широких линий при выделении их в модели
- Позволено изменять значение avp.ENABLE_INLINE_WORKER во время выполнения
- viewer.clearSelection не запускает событие в случае, если в момент запуска метода в модели не было ничего выбрано
- исправлены проблемы выпуска v6.1, приводившие к тому, что из-за несовместимых библиотек 2D листы отображались черным. URL-ы зависимых библиотек теперь указывают на корректные версии
Источник: https://forge.autodesk.com/blog/viewer-release-notes-v-63
Обсуждение: http://adn-cis.org/forum/index.php?topic=
Опубликовано 30.11.2018